Causes of obesity

 Obesity arises from a complex interplay of factors:

1. **Diet**: Consuming more calories than expended leads to weight gain. Diets high in fats, sugars, and processed foods often contribute to obesity.

  

2. **Physical Inactivity**: Sedentary lifestyles, due to increased screen time or jobs requiring minimal physical activity, can contribute to weight gain.


3. **Genetics**: Some people are genetically predisposed to obesity, with certain genes affecting fat storage and energy expenditure.


4. **Metabolism**: The rate at which the body burns calories can vary among people, and slower metabolic rates might contribute to weight accumulation.


5. **Hormonal Imbalances**: Conditions like pol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S), Cushing's syndrome, and hypothyroidism can lead to weight gain.


6. **Medications**: Some drugs, such as antidepressants, antipsychotics, and corticosteroids, have weight gain as a side effect.


7. **Psychological Factors**: Stress, emotional trauma, and depression can lead to overeating as a coping mechanism.


8. **Environmental Factors**: Living in "food deserts" (areas with limited access to healthy foods) or in places with few opportunities for physical activity can contribute.


9. **Sociocultural Influences**: Cultural norms and peer pressure can influence eating habits and attitudes toward body weight.


10. **Sleep**: Lack of sleep or poor-quality sleep can disrupt hormones that regulate appetite and lead to weight gain.


11. **Gut Bacteria**: The composition of gut microbiota can influence how food is digested and how fat is stored in the body.
